About Psycho Jawntis
Gregg-Bass and vocals
Adam-Rhythm guitar and vocals
Dale-Lead guitar and vocals
Pete-Drums
Brought together by circumstances beyond their control (some may call
it coincidence, some may call it God) "Bad Wolf" (formally "The Delray Beach Boys, "The A1A-Holes" and "Clark & the Griswolds") are set off to knock the ever-loving s%@t out of you.
When Gregg's powerful, energetic, melodic and psychotic bass lines and his raw raspy, raucous and wide range vocals combine with Adam's rock solid, salient rhythm guitar and his well rounded, warm vocals...magic happens!!!
Add Dale on lead guitar, lead vocals and background vocals. His versatility and eclectic influences lend perfectly to the aural sound-scape.
Pete lends the beat. His economical approach combined with his finesse provides a foundation that is unshakable.
Oh and lets not forget about their songwriting. Sweat, tears, blood, heart ache, joy, and a whole lot of other stuff have been jammed into their well crafted, fantastically arranged tunes. You be the judge.
